Forbearance vs Temperance - What's the difference?
forbearance | temperance |As nouns the difference between forbearance and temperance
is that forbearance is patient self-control; restraint and tolerance under provocation while temperance is habitual moderation in regard to the indulgence of the natural appetites and passions; restrained or moderate indulgence; moderation; as, temperance in eating and drinking; temperance in the indulgence of joy or mirth; specifically, moderation, and sometimes abstinence, in respect to using intoxicating liquors.As a proper noun Temperance is
